What are the system requirements for the patient portal?

The Patient Portal is web-based, so most up-to-date versions of browsers such as Internet Explorer, Firefox, Chrome, Safari. Most operating systems such as Windows and Mac OS are also compatible with the Patient Portal.

Is the information on the patient portal secure?

The information on the Patient Portal is merely a snapshot of your medical record, not the actual record. Portal records are maintained on a secure server. NHFM uses encryption technology that is HIPAA compliant to keep your information secure. NHFM will not disclose your email address to any third party without prior written consent.

How long does it take to respond to a message from a doctor?

Messages and requests will be responded to as quickly as possible, usually within 48/72 hours. Many requests will only be processed during your physician’s normal office hours, as they are patient specific, medical issues. So please be patient with us.
